Output cae397010c6ec385364dc3f17a4acbb27b5a9ed2d8385134aad6703512180ecc:1

value
18288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43142a3bca7d5a997d3529de3006ab720a8d6b65 OP_EQUAL
address
37ohMUzS3JXKQNgBsv6ryTzqJDFJc9w55R
transaction
cae397010c6ec385364dc3f17a4acbb27b5a9ed2d8385134aad6703512180ecc
confirmations
74363
spent
true